Wawa Goes to Florida: What to Expect from Models in New Markets
Katherine Dillon – Real Estate and SOS Finance Manager, Wawa, Inc.
Brian Pomykacz - Manager of Real Estate, Florida, Wawa, Inc.
Paige Stover – Senior Director of Analytics, Forum Analytics
Wawa, Inc., a privately held company, began in 1803 as an iron foundry in New Jersey. Toward the end of the 19th century, owner George Wood took an interest in dairy farming and the family began a small processing plant in Wawa, PA, in 1902. The milk business was a huge success. Today, Wawa is an all day, every day stop for fresh, built-to-order foods, beverages, coffee, and fuel services. A chain of more than 645 convenience retail stores (over 365 offering gasoline), Wawa stores are located in Pennsylvania, New Jersey, Delaware, Maryland, Virginia, and Central Florida.
Ms. Dillon, Mr. Pomykacz and Ms. Stover explore the difficulties of building forecasting models from historical data for use in entirely new markets. When Wawa decided to expand to the Florida market, Forum helped design and implement a forecasting model from legacy data but with sensitivities to the unique market dynamics of this uncharted state. A candid dialog about what worked, what didn’t, and how to set expectations inside your organization under such circumstances.

Story Time with CKE: How Multiple Brands Share a Single SIMMS Online Platform
Mike Sawyer – Director of Market Planning, CKE Restaurants, Inc.
Sarah Baumgartner – Chief Client Officer, Forum Analytics
Carl’s Jr. is celebrating more than 70 years in the quick-service industry. What began in 1941 as a lone hot dog cart in Los Angeles is today a wholly owned subsidiary of CKE Restaurants Holdings, Inc. As of the end of fiscal 2013, the company, through its subsidiaries, had a total of 3,318 franchised or company-operated restaurants in 42 states and 28 foreign countries and U.S. territories worldwide, including 1,369 Carl's Jr. restaurants and 1,944 Hardees’s restaurants.
Mr. Sawyer and Ms. Baumgartner will discuss how multiple brands utilize the same SIMMS Online platform to solve similar but uniquely different real estate needs. They’ll discuss how SIMMS Online has evolved over the years and what role the analytics derived play in the day to day decision making across the enterprise.

Ace Means Business: How Ace Hardware Uses SIMMS Online to Target High-Value Business to Business Customers
Bruce Rohm – Business to Business Corporate Manager, Ace Hardware
Paige Stover – Senior Director of Analytics, Forum Analytics
Mr. Rohm will discuss the B2B channel at Ace Hardware and the challenges they face in driving incremental growth through this channel with their independent store owners and operators. The approach and lessons learned are applicable to any business trying to drive incremental revenue growth through non-traditional channels. Learn how Forum helped narrow the focus through business segmentation modeling and how such modeling can be applied to many other B2B and B2C situations.
